Description

A kind of electric wheelchair of energy stair activity
Technical field
This utility model relate to a kind of can the electric wheelchair of stair activity, being a kind of machinery, is that one is help the disabled equipment, is a kind ofly to help the upper device downstairs of people with disability by mechanical means.
Background technology
Along with the progress of society, people more and more pay close attention to the such disadvantaged group of people with disability, more pay close attention to the dignity respecting people with disability in the process helping people with disability, by arranging some succinct equipment easily, enable them to autonomous complete the easy action completed of ordinary person, such as stair activity.Traditional wheelchair, owing to there being wheel, is difficult to stair activity.Although in recent years, people with disability ramp has all been built in public place, and in many cases, stair still hinder the major obstacle of wheelchair action.In recent years constantly someone invent various can the wheelchair of stair activity, but these Wheelchair structures are too complicated, easily break down, and price is also too high, and majority cannot be accepted.In addition, because wheelchair is in upper process of going downstairs, the seat of wheelchair tilts with the angle of stair, and the people be sitting on wheelchair also tilts with the gradient of stair, feels uncomfortable, also hampers the universal of electronic stair activity wheelchair.
Summary of the invention
In order to overcome the problem of prior art, the utility model proposes a kind of electric wheelchair of energy stair activity.Described electric wheelchair, by a fork modified gear, switches, and can make wheelchair maintenance level in the process of stair activity between road wheel and crawler belt.

Detailed description of the invention
Embodiment one:
The present embodiment is a kind of electric wheelchair of energy stair activity, as shown in Figure 1, 2.Fig. 1 is a sectional view, and wheelchair is in state upstairs, and Fig. 2 is the outline drawing of wheelchair, and wheelchair is in the state walked in level land.The present embodiment comprises: left and right installs the track frame 5 of two electric caterpillar bands 6 respectively, and described track frame front end is connected with fork positioner framework 3 by hinge 301, and described rear end, fork positioner framework both sides arranges a large land route road wheel 7 respectively.The middle rear end of described track frame is connected with one end of rocking bar connecting device 8 by hinge 501, the other end of described rocking bar connecting device is connected with seat frame 1 rear end by hinge 801, and described seat frame front end is arranged little universal travel wheel 4 and is connected with fork positioner framework by hinge 101.Described seat frame is connected with electric pushrod 2 respectively by hinge 201,202 with fork positioner framework.
The key of the present embodiment is four supports and electric pushrod, forms the double leval jib modified gear of folding.Four rack rods are: the rocking bar connecting device after track frame, seat frame, fork positioner framework and seat frame.Track frame is equivalent to fixed mount, fork positioner framework and seat frame are realized angle adjustment by electric pushrod, thus complete the conversion of the two kinds of operating modes in terraced road of electric wheelchair, their angles change the size displacement produced and are eliminated by the rocking bar connecting device swing after seat frame, and it is substantially constant that rocking bar connecting device limits wheelchair centre-height under two kinds of operating modes simultaneously.
Track frame has various ways, and its basic comprising is: electric caterpillar band and the middle connector of two parallel installations are formed.Electric caterpillar band can use two lamellar plate wheel shafts to connect into framework, wheel shaft is arranged support wheel and support board structure.Article two, electric caterpillar band by a driven by motor, also can be driven by two motors respectively.Electric caterpillar band can have various ways, and its basic comprising is one, one end drivewheel other end is a follower, and there are multiple support wheel and support board structure in centre, makes crawler belt keep the smooth-going of motion.For convenience of stair climbing, can tilt in one end setting unit of crawler belt, form approach angle (departure angle).Connector in the middle of track frame can be section bars that are square, circular or other shapes.
Seat frame is by the shelf of a seat plane, reconnects a backrest and forms seat.The front portion of seat arranges a little universal land route road wheel, rear portion establish one with the hinge of rocking bar connecting device, the middle part of seat arranges a hinge be connected with fork positioner framework, in this typical quadric chain, under the effect of electric pushrod, there is scissors movement in seat frame and fork positioner framework.Crawler frame is fixed pole (relatively whole quadric chain) in this quadric chain, seat frame does scissors movement under the constraint of middle part hinge and fork positioner framework and the anterior hinge of crawler frame, make seat frame parallel or tilting relative to crawler frame under the effect of electric pushrod, seat plane (with the position of people's sitting posture lower contacts) by also thereupon parallel or tilt, as shown in Figure 1, 2.When seat plane tilts time, the angle of tilting close to or equal the inclination angle of stair.This scissors movement can cause the position dimension of these two connecting rod link axles to change, and at this moment seat frame can move by anterior-posterior horizontal, and move distance is eliminated by the swing of rocking bar connecting device.When stair climbing, crawler belt is with the angular slope of stair, and seat becomes level, sees Fig. 1, and wheelchair-bound people can be made like this to feel comfortable.When seat plane is parallel with crawler belt plane, when namely electric pushrod is packed up, large and small road wheel all kiss the earths, make crawler belt lift, and wheelchair is in level walking state, as shown in Figure 2.
Fork positioner framework is a frame-shaped structure that can be formed by two fork crossbeams side by side or connecting rod.One end of fork positioner framework is hingedly connected on track frame, and fork positioner framework can be changed around this hinge.The other end of fork positioner framework arranges large row land route travelling wheel, arranges a hinge be connected with seat frame in large row land route travelling wheel and the position between track frame hinge.This hinge in the middle of fork positioner framework, can promote seat frame and lift change angle, and retrains the degree of freedom of seat frame motion.Simultaneously because fork becomes the effect of seat in the plane framework, large land route road wheel is made to increase or to decline.When fork positioner framework is backed down by electric pushrod, large land route road wheel rises, and wheelchair is in the state of going upstairs, as shown in Figure 1, when fork positioner framework is set level, large land route road wheel and little universal land route road wheel and earth surface, wheelchair is in the state of level walking, as shown in Figure 2.
The large land route road wheel that fork positioner framework is arranged can be motorless hand-pushing wheel, also can mounted motor, becomes the electric wheelchair that level land is run.Two the large road wheels in left and right can arrange two motors respectively, also can use a driven by motor.Use two motors to drive the large land route road wheel on both sides respectively, can unify to control, also can control respectively, control with controller is unified, two wheels can be realized move respectively, complete the advance in land route, retrogressing, turning function, to increase the motility of operation.
Described electric pushrod is arranged on a position very cleverly, just completes the folding of seat frame and fork positioner framework, wheelchair is completed and is converted to stair climbing by level walking with (top) push rod, or contrary action.Whole process is very simple, just can complete with a handle controller.If be equipped with simple program control system, the present embodiment can complete the conversion of climbing building state walking states pacifically automatically, make people with disability depart from other people help completely, and complete self-dependent strength completes downstairs, greatly can improve the confidence of people with disability to life like this.
Wheelchair enters the process that stair enter downwards on stair top, or stair climbing enters in the process of plane to top, due to the movement of center of gravity, has a upset suddenly.This process can make to take advantage of wheelchair-bound people very uncomfortable, has a kind of sensation out of control.For addressing this problem, a tail wheel can be increased at the rear portion of seat, when entering stair downwards, or upwards leaving stair when entering level land, with tail wheel as support, control wheelchair and avoid unexpected upset.Tail wheel can be connected through the hinge on framework, manually or electric pushrod make tail wheel pole open or pack up.

Embodiment two:
The present embodiment is the improvement of embodiment one, is the refinement of embodiment one about track frame.Track frame described in the present embodiment comprises: two, left and right is provided with the framework of multiple crawler belt support wheel 504 and support board structure 503, two described frameworks are fixedly connected with by many connecting rods 502, be arranged on framework or connecting rod with the hinge of fork positioner framework and rocking bar connecting device, as shown in Figure 1, 2.
Framework described in the present embodiment is two panels structural material, links together with multiple minor axis, and minor axis is provided with crawler belt support wheel and support board structure.Because stair are equivalent to the envelope plane of rib one rib, so support wheel and support board structure can avoid the impact of crawler belt rib one rib on stair, crawler belt is run more steady.
In two main support rollers of crawler belt front and back end, one of them toothed belt wheel is drivewheel, drives belt to run.Belt internal ring is provided with band tooth, is convenient to drivewheel and drives.The outer surface of belt also needs to arrange fin, to increase the frictional force with stair or bottom surface.
Bottom stair, for enable crawler belt smooth-going from level land enter stair climbing state, or get off smooth-going to enter level land from stair, approach angle or departure angle can be set in the end of crawler belt, even if the end of crawler belt tilts.But because wheelchair is less, the tilting all arranging crawler belt at two ends is unrealistic, crawler belt at one end can be set and tilts, make wheelchair always bottom stair, enter stair with a direction or leave stair.
By the connecting rod that two frameworks are fixed together, can be bar, can be also section bar, as square tube section, or pipe section bar etc.
Embodiment three:
The present embodiment is the refinement of embodiment two, is the refinement of embodiment two about framework.One end of framework described in the present embodiment arranges the approach angle that crawler belt is tilted α, as shown in Figure 1.
Chair due to wheelchair in the present embodiment is tilt when stair activity, horizontal, therefore, when wheelchair bottom stair close to stair time, can only from rear portion (after the backrest of chair) stair of climbing, that is must the opposing and stair climbing in people face and the wheelchair direction of advancing.Therefore, the approach angle set by the present embodiment is also arranged on the rear portion of wheelchair.Because stair activity is all toward or away from stair by rear portion, therefore, the approach angle described in the present embodiment also can think departure angle.
Arranging approach angle actual is the shape changing framework, and framework arranges the support wheel changing crawler belt shape, forms the tilting of crawler belt.
Embodiment four:
The present embodiment is the improvement of embodiment three, is the refinement of embodiment three about crawler belt.Two, left and right described in the present embodiment framework is arranged respectively the motor driving crawler belt running.
The present embodiment is actually uses driven by motor respectively by two crawler belts, and control respectively, such two crawler belts can asynchronously rotate, and two crawler belts can be made to produce the different speeds of service when manipulation, wheelchair can be manipulated with this to turn, change the traffic direction of whole wheelchair.This point is also very useful when stair activity, the direction of adjustment wheelchair on stair that the people of a wheelchair can be made autonomous.But be not that two crawler belts must operate by different driven by motor, a motor also can be used simultaneously to drive two crawler belts, just in crawler belt running, if error appears in direction, adjustment direction can be helped by the assistant of push boat chair.This uses the advantage of the scheme of a driven by motor two crawler belts to be that structure is simple, and cost is low, for still there being certain benefit people with disability hard up economically.
Embodiment five:
The present embodiment is the improvement of embodiment one, is the refinement of embodiment one about fork positioner framework.Fork positioner framework described in the present embodiment comprises: the fork that two, left and right is bending, fork described in two is fixedly connected with by cross bar 301, one end of described fork is connected with framework by hinge, the other end is connected with large land route road wheel, between the hinge that described fork positioner framework is connected with framework and large land route road wheel, the hinge be connected with seat frame is set, as shown in Figure 1.
Fork positioner framework connects the connector between large land route road wheel and framework.This link comprises two forks in left and right, and centre cross bar is fixed together, and forms I shape.One end of fork positioner framework is connected with frame hinge, makes fork positioner framework can around this pivot, and the middle part of fork positioner framework arranges the hinge be connected with seat frame, makes fork positioner framework and seat frame form the effect supporting and swing.The other end of fork positioner framework arranges large land route road wheel.Owing to being two forks in left and right, so there are two the large road wheels in left and right, form two, the left and right support wheel of wheelchair.The effect that fork positioner framework swings makes the road wheel lifting of large land route, alternately becomes the movement parts of walking with crawler belt.
Embodiment six:
The present embodiment is the improvement of embodiment one, is the refinement of embodiment one about seat frame.Seat frame described in the present embodiment comprises: the supporting plate installing seat, the rear end of described supporting plate arranges the hinge be connected with rocking bar connecting device, the front end of described supporting plate is fixedly connected with little universal travel wheel, arranges the hinge be connected with fork positioner framework in the middle part of described supporting plate.
The main body of seat frame is the supporting plate of seat, or is bench, and the rear portion of bench is fixedly connected with backrest, and the left and right sides arranges handrail.Certain backrest also should swing, and to change the angle of backrest, increases comfort.The front portion of seat is fixedly connected with a little universal travel wheel, as the support of wheelchair when level walking with turn to.The rear portion of seat frame is provided with the hinge be connected with rocking bar positioner framework, and middle part arranges the hinge be connected with seat frame, and whole seat frame can do plane rocking under the combined effect of these two hinges, namely lifts or sets level.Seat frame is lifted by electric pushrod or sets level.
Embodiment seven:
The present embodiment is the improvement of above-described embodiment, is the refinement of above-described embodiment about framework.Back-end framework described in the present embodiment is connected with tail wheel frame 9 by hinge, and the top of described tail wheel frame arranges large tail wheel 10, as Fig. 3.
Tail wheel frame described in the present embodiment is actual is exactly a long rod-shaped member.One end of stock is connected with framework by hinge, and the other end arranges large tail wheel.
The effect of large tail wheel improves wheelchair to have level when going downstairs in stair top to the ride comfort of overbank, or reach stair top when going upstairs from the ride comfort being tilted to excessive levels.
When wheelchair enters stair on the top of stair by level or has stair to enter level, one all can be had to tilt suddenly or unexpected level, for addressing this problem, the present embodiment is provided with tail wheel frame on framework.
When stair top climbed to by wheelchair, also in heeling condition, just first open tail wheel frame, make tail wheel first touch the ground of level, then wheelchair continues to climb, and packs up tail wheel frame then in good time, makes smooth-going the landing of whole wheelchair.If use electronic tail wheel frame, can also automatically control in good time the lifting and putting down of tail wheel frame by controller, realize smooth-going completely, as shown in Figure 3.
In like manner, wheelchair enters stair also tail wheel frame can be used to realize excessively smooth-going from stair top.
Embodiment eight:
The present embodiment is the improvement of embodiment seven, is the refinement of embodiment seven about tail wheel frame.Tail wheel frame described in the present embodiment also sets multiple little tail wheel 11 in a row, as shown in Figure 4.
The object that tail wheel frame sets in a row little tail wheel increases its ride comfort when being the stair in order to wheelchair up and down ramp is less.As shown in Figure 4, if stair angle is less, and step is longer, just there will be to be similar to above-mentioned wheelchair and to reach or leave this situation of stair top, and at this moment wheelchair will constantly " be beated ".Just can improve this situation after increasing tail wheel and little tail wheel, avoid operating the beating of wheelchair.
Embodiment nine:
The present embodiment is the improvement of above-described embodiment, is the refinement of above-described embodiment about tail wheel frame.Tail wheel frame described in the present embodiment is connected 12 with manually opened tail wheel pole, as shown in Figure 4.
Tail wheel pole can receive and open, and is supported on tail wheel frame, and tail wheel frame should set up multiple fulcrum, uses different fulcrums as required.
Embodiment ten:
The present embodiment is the improvement of above-described embodiment, is the refinement of above-described embodiment about tail wheel frame.Tail wheel frame described in the present embodiment is connected with electric pushrod.
Arrange electric pushrod at tail wheel frame, control the opening angle of tail wheel frame with controller, the angle changing tail wheel frame as required that can be in good time, adapts to various different situation, makes the stair activity of wheelchair more smooth-going.
